About [6-[[4-[3-(diethylamino)quinoxalin-6-yl]-5-fluoropyrimidin-2-yl]amino]-3-pyridinyl]-(4-ethylpiperazin-1-yl)methanone

[6-[[4-[3-(diethylamino)quinoxalin-6-yl]-5-fluoropyrimidin-2-yl]amino]-3-pyridinyl]-(4-ethylpiperazin-1-yl)methanone (PubChem CID 166627597) has the molecular formula C28H32FN9O and a molecular weight of 529.62 g/mol. Its IUPAC name is [6-[[4-[3-(diethylamino)quinoxalin-6-yl]-5-fluoropyrimidin-2-yl]amino]-3-pyridinyl]-(4-ethylpiperazin-1-yl)methanone.
